Dan, The return spring in the pump goes haywire and collapses. That is the noise you hear. There is a trick to holding the push rod up so you can get the arm under it. Be VERY careful, DO NOT get the arm "ON" the push rod, it will not work, and may bend something. Pull the bolt out on the front of the block that is even with the pump and put a longer one in, push the rod up with your finger and "SNUG" the longer bolt against the rod just enough to hold it up. DO NOT forget to replace the short bolt, once you get the new pump in, could create a problem with rod. I also have a good pump handy. Am I off topic?
